Introduction

This guide will explain how to set up the artifacts for the "Automating Ad hoc Data Representation Transformation" paper.

There are two artifacts described in the paper:

There are ways to explore the artifact:

  • using the demo virtual machine, you will be able to try out the code transformations done by the ildl-plugin and miniboxing-plugin and explore the code in an IDE
  • using a local installation, you will be able to do everything and run the benchmarks (the installation is preferably done on a *nix system)

We strongly recommend replicating the benchmarks directly on the host machine. We tried to replicate the benchmarks in the virtual machine and were unable to, most likely due to the 32-bit system architecture and the overhead of virtualization.
